Output 3975376a4115b87d3a084c1d83d42a5a955f03b26cf1d234cbaaa7254e4923d4:5

value
23483325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c92ebf9916db03967f26b9d1bdc572fa2437cae OP_EQUAL
address
MU1StwHz5NBFmKGzuNACisTVMbNrDuwkXk
transaction
3975376a4115b87d3a084c1d83d42a5a955f03b26cf1d234cbaaa7254e4923d4
spent
true